GDMS Analysis


General Specifications

  • The VG9000 Glow Discharge Mass Spectrometer (VG Elemental, UK) is used for both our production control and regular service measurements for customers from all over the world.
  • The VG9000 Glow Discharge Mass Spectrometer is widely used for the characterization of inorganic solids. Typically the system is used for the direct analysis of trace and ultratrace constituents in high purity metals and semiconductors.
  • Advantages:
    • rapid and direct analysis of solids
    • limits of detection in the range 0.5 to 5 ppb are typically achieved
    • low matrix effects
    • reliable quantitation
  • The liberation of material from the sample is completely independent of the ionization process. The independence minimizes matrix effects and enables quantitative data to be obtained with the minimum use of standards. Utilization of both Faraday cup and Daly detector enables to determine major and trace elements in a single analysis cycle.
  • During sixteen years we have gained an experience in purity certification of those materials as: Ga, GaAs, In, As, GaP, InSb, InP, Sb, InAs, Ge, Si, Al, CdTe, Cu, Zr, Ti, Ta, Pt, Pt-Rh, Au, Hg, steels, magnet alloy, Mo, W, Ga2O3, TiO2, and graphite.

Limits of Detection

  • Basically we do analysis under two conditions which differ by integration time ie. time of one analysis run. Therefore the results can be drawn as typical or low limit of detection (LOD). For example both of LOD for Gallium and GaAs are shown in the table.

Sampling

  • The sample to be analysed is in form of the pin with diameter max. 3 mm or cross section 2 x 2 mm and lenght max. 22 mm. We need at least two pins from every sample or adequate part of sample to be able to cut to pin form. In case of wafer it could be a part of wafer with with thickness of 0,2 mm minimum. Regarding Gallium samples we need the minimum 10 g packed in PE bottle or bag.
